On the 60-day IL before the cutoff, so he is on the eligibility list. He has served 56 of the 60 required days (eligible to be activated from Sep 18), then must be reinstated to the 40-man and 26-man.
The post-season eligibility list is fixed at noon ET on September 1: everyone on the 40-man, the 60-day IL or the military list at that moment, who then stays there without interruption. Attachment 25 (Major League Rule 40)

- designate him for assignment (or put him on outright waivers)
- The club has 7 days to trade him, pass him through outright waivers, or release him; he is paid at the major-league rate and keeps accruing service in the meantime. On outright waivers any club can claim him for $50,000, worst record first, and the claiming club takes his contract (2 yr, $14.5M (2026-27), 2028 club option). If he clears, he cannot be outrighted without his consent: he can refuse and force a release with his contract intact, or elect free agency (forfeiting termination pay). Post-season: an outright after the September 1 cutoff ends his automatic eligibility. He could only return as an approved injury replacement, and only if he accepts the outright and stays on a minor-league reserve list in the organization without interruption; a release makes him ineligible for anyone this October. Because he is on the injured list he cannot be outrighted until he is healthy and reinstated, so a DFA now would have to end in a trade or a release. With real money left on the contract a claim is unlikely; the usual outcome is clearing waivers, then release, with the club paying the balance less what a new club pays him.

- release him
- Release waivers cost a claiming club $1 but the claimant assumes the whole contract, so expensive players clear. The club owes the full unpaid balance of this season's salary, offset by whatever another club pays him this year. The guaranteed years remain owed in full. A released player is not post-season eligible for any club this year.

What the rules say about him
- Article XIX-A: five years, no forced assignment8+047 of MLB service through 2025: can refuse an optional assignment and cannot be outrighted without consent.A player with five or more years of Major League service cannot be assigned anywhere but another Major League club without his written consent.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Article XIX(A)(2), p. 94
- Article XIX-A: five years, no forced outright5+ years of service: an outright assignment requires his consent; otherwise the club must keep, trade or release him.A player with five or more years of service can refuse an outright assignment altogether; the club must then keep him, trade him, or release him.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Article XIX(A)(2), p. 94
- Article XX-B free agency6+ years of service but under contract through 2028.Six or more years of service with an expiring contract: free agent at 9 AM ET the day after the last World Series game.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Article XX(B)(1)-(2), p. 102
- 60-day IL and the November crunchOn the 60-day IL: not counting against the 40-man now, but must be reinstated by Nov 5 (5th day after the World Series).A player on the 60-day IL is off the 40-man, but every 60-day IL player must be reinstated after the World Series, healthy or not.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Article XIII(C), p. 56 (the number itself is in Major League Rule 2)
- Injured players cannot be sent downOn the Major League injured list: cannot be optioned or outrighted until he is healthy and reinstated, so an injured fringe player keeps his roster spot by default.No assignment to a minor-league club while a player is on a Major League injured list, and an injured player who cannot play cannot be optioned or outrighted.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Article XIX(C)(1)-(2), p. 96
- Post-season roster eligibilityOn the 60-day IL before the cutoff, so he is on the eligibility list. He has served 56 of the 60 required days (eligible to be activated from Sep 18), then must be reinstated to the 40-man and 26-man.The post-season eligibility list is fixed at noon ET on September 1: everyone on the 40-man, the 60-day IL or the military list at that moment, who then stays there without interruption. 2022-2026 Basic Agreement, Attachment 25, p. 253 (the number itself is in Major League Rule 40)
